PS6610 Hardware Owner's Manual 1 Basic Storage Array Information • Use telnet or SSH to connect to a functioning IP address assigned to a network interface on the array. Do not connect to the group IP address. • Use the null modem cable, shipped with the array, to connect the serial port on the active control module (ACT LED is green) to a console or a computer running a terminal emulator. Make sure the serial line characteristics are as follows: • 9600 baud • One STOP bit • No parity • 8 data bits • No flow control 2. Log in to an account with read-write access, such as the grpadmin account. 3. Enter the shutdown command: login: grpadmin Password: Welcome to Group Manager Copyright 2001-2014 Dell Inc. group1> shutdown After entering the shutdown command, the system displays information similar to the following output: Do you really want to shutdown the system? (yes/no) Halt at Fri Dec 12 09:43:44 EST 2014 -- please wait... 6932:0:logevent:12-Dec-2014 09:43:44.400000:logevent.cc:238:WARNING::25.3.0: User has initiated a clean halt restart. Main power usage is 68.5702 watts sbs_ship_mode: Ship Mode request sent to battery PLEASE WAIT FOR SHIP MODE CONFIRMATION MESSAGE!! Waiting for Ship Mode entry: 5 sec Waiting for Ship Mode entry: 10 sec Waiting for Ship Mode entry: 15 sec Waiting for Ship Mode entry: 20 sec Waiting for Ship Mode entry: 25 sec Waiting for Ship Mode entry: 30 sec Check peer controller completion No peer responding, peer battery is off Batteries are now in Ship Mode! Placing array in standby mode. To exit standby mode press and hold a standby switch on any controller in the array. 4. Switch off the enclosure power supplies. Note: If you are using a network connection, the session will be disconnected before the array is fully shut down. Confirm that the ACT LED on each control module is off (not lit) before turning off power to the array at the power supply. 7
